Susanna Jones

Susanna Jones has written 4 standalone novels, starting with The Earthquake Bird in 2001. The most recently released novel was When Nights Were Cold, which was released in 2012. There are no upcoming standalone novels by Susanna at this time.

Susanna Jones: Awards & Accolades

Jones' book, The Earthquake Bird won the Crime Writer's Association Award, New Blood Dagger Award, in 2001.
